The session "What’s new in device management" at WWDC 2024 covers several updates related to certificates and profiles. Here are some key points:

  1. Device Management Renaming: The profile section has been renamed to device management and moved under general settings, aligning more closely with iPhone and iPad settings.

  2. Beta Program Management: Organizations can enforce and defer beta releases on supervised devices. A declarative status report provides visibility into beta program enrollments.

  3. Service Configuration Files: Support for installing service configuration files, including executable files, has been added. This allows IT admins to install management tools and scripts in a tamper-resistant location.

  4. Software Update Management: New features include managing notification behavior for software updates and beta updates, making it easier to manage beta program participation.

  5. Security and Enrollment: In iOS 18, enrolling an MDM on a newly set up device without familiar locations will not cause a security delay for the first 3 hours after stolen device protection is enabled.
